Output 61239bf69fab7441560e5451be50203f34d273a3ebd8625c113efb016f8f90cc:5

value
70852997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ba2ce604044a07ef8da116b9ddec1c4570de313 OP_EQUAL
address
MBstKebHV6b7ywGVZT8p3mP3k5n4Pkhw5Q
transaction
61239bf69fab7441560e5451be50203f34d273a3ebd8625c113efb016f8f90cc
spent
true